Abstract
It is an object to obtain a highly efficient synchronous induction motor by letting the magnetic flux hardly pass in the direction of a q axis without interrupting a magnetic path in the direction of a d axis and by increasing a salient pole difference. A slit next to a shaftis extended towards the shaft along a circumference of the shaftto form an extended part of slit. In addition, a gas vent holeis formed as a slender opening stretched in the direction of d axis, and a slit is projected along the circumference of the gas vent hole. Further, the gas vent holeis formed as a slender opening stretched in the direction which is displaced by a predetermined angle from the d axis. Yet further, a rotor iron coreis formed by a plurality of rotor iron core portions in the laminating direction, and the rotor iron core portions have different shapes of slits, respectively.
